What Skills Are Helpful For This Pouf Project?
The floor pouf crochet pattern from MJ’s Off The Hook Designs was designed with intermediate crocheters in mind. However, those with a good understanding of fundamental crochet techniques should find it achievable as well, thanks to an easy-to-follow video guide.
To be able to work it, you should know how to crochet stitches in rounds. The pattern also uses front post double crochets to create raised textural details.
Yarn Weight Is Required For The Pattern
Nothing will make your crochet pouf as chunky as super bulky weight yarn, so be sure to use it for this project. The designer picked Mary Maxim Starlette Chunky, but you can go for any other brand you like. A great choice would also be Lion Brand Hometown or Bernat Softee Chunky Solids. You will need approx 700-1506 yards (640-1377 m) to complete it.
If you’d like to achieve a striking pumpkin look, consider using a fiery orange shade or some earthy colors like brown.
What Is The Best Filling For The Crochet Pouf?
It’s really up to you what stuffing you will use. If the pouf is intended to be sat on, go for bean bag filling that will keep it firm and well-shaped even after frequent use. Another option is to stuff your pouf with a big bag of polyester fiberfill.
And if you’re looking for a budget-friendly solution, you can put old pillows, clothes, or duvets inside, but this may make it harder to achieve a perfectly round and springy shape.
